The Certificate in Advanced Health Policy and Law is a postgraduate program designed to equip students with the knowledge and skills necessary to navigate the complex healthcare landscape.
This program focuses on the intersection of health policy and law, providing students with a deep understanding of the regulatory frameworks that govern healthcare systems.
Through a combination of theoretical and practical coursework, students will learn about the key concepts, principles, and practices that shape health policy and law, including healthcare financing, access to care, and medical ethics.
The program's learning outcomes include the ability to analyze complex healthcare issues, develop effective policy solutions, and communicate with stakeholders in the healthcare industry.
The duration of the Certificate in Advanced Health Policy and Law is typically one year, with students completing a series of coursework and capstone projects.
Industry relevance is a key aspect of this program, as it prepares students for careers in healthcare policy, law, and advocacy.
Graduates of the program can pursue careers in government agencies, non-profit organizations, private industry, and academia, working on issues such as healthcare reform, regulatory policy, and public health.
